Hi Jon.
I also believe the group of 4 kanji are "Trademark" or something similar. They are unreadable.
In the group of 3 I just can read the first 大(tai,dai or ō) which means big and the third 心(kokoro or shin) which means heart. So what we have so far is just big heart.
Can you focus better on the second kanji please?
Ok, so the second kanji seems to be 和 (wa), but following the 大 kanji the reading of the two kanji together is Yamato. So it should be Yamato Shin, but again a bigger pic might be helpful.
